“WebAssembly: A Game-Changer in Web Development”

WebAssembly, often referred to as wasm, has emerged as a groundbreaking technology in web development that is revolutionizing the way we build applications for the web. It is a low-level tecode that serves as a standard binary format for web browsers, providing faster execution speeds and improved performance compared to traditional JavaScript. WebAssembly opens up new possibilities for building complex and resource-intensive web applications, such as games, simulations, multimedia processing, and more.

WebAssembly offers several advantages that make it a game-changer in web development. Firstly, it enables developers to write applications using languages other than JavaScript, such as C, C++, and Rust, which are known for their performance and low-level capabilities. This allows developers to leverage their existing skills and libraries to build applications that were previously difficult to achieve on the web platform. With WebAssembly, developers can now create complex applications for the web that are on par with native desktop software.

Secondly, the performance gains provided WebAssembly are significant. By compiling code to WebAssembly, applications can execute at near-native speeds, eliminating the performance bottleneck often associated with JavaScript. This improved efficiency translates into faster load times, smoother user experiences, and the ability to handle resource-intensive tasks more efficiently. As a result, web developers can now build highly interactive and computationally demanding applications without sacrificing performance.

Lastly, WebAssembly is designed to be platform-independent and backwards-compatible, making it a reliable and future-proof solution for web development. It provides a standardized approach that works across different browsers and operating systems, ensuring consistent results regardless of the user’s device or configuration. Moreover, WebAssembly can coexist seamlessly with JavaScript, allowing developers to blend the two technologies and harness the strengths of each to create powerful and flexible web applications.

In conclusion, WebAssembly is undoubtedly a game-changer in web development due to its ability to unlock new possibilities, improve performance, and ensure compatibility across different platforms. As more developers adopt this technology, we can expect to see a new wave of innovative web applications that were previously only possible on native platforms. WebAssembly represents a significant leap forward in the evolution of web development and has the potential to reshape the way we build and experience web applications.
